Output 0563a26cfba48d6671fb2756be8339d3fb710f12f43471ae17ec3b1624750161:6

value
1507816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a993eddb40831351dc1497bf442eb3a909e27d92 OP_EQUAL
address
3H9fLFyaGXNDWw9VVgzuXwUyUkCnmuhxcE
transaction
0563a26cfba48d6671fb2756be8339d3fb710f12f43471ae17ec3b1624750161
spent
true